Family, along with former students and colleagues, turned out in their numbers to pay their respects to late educator this afternoon.
Mr. Sealy, who became the first principal of the then Garrison Secondary School when it opened in 1975, died last month at the age of 94.
Today, his body lay in repose at the school which was renamed in his honour in 2012.
Harold Ruck, who taught at the school under Mr. Sealy’s leadership, says many students went on to excel because they were given a place at the institution.
A number of former students also spoke highly of the late principal.
